  20. My suggestion would be to pick up a sleeve of balls you would like to try and compare them side by side, hole by hole. Played correctly Bump and run shouldn't have any check. Also, some advocate when testing a new ball to start at the green and work your way back to the tee. ie: test it on the green, how does it feel off the putter? Chip and pitching: fell good, get what you want or no not really. You get my drift? It's all feel, your feel, you have to decide. Good luck
